Job Description
Responsibilities The Senior Product Cost Analyst serves as a valued business partner with strong business acumen who develops labor and overhead rates to establish accurate cost foundations. This role applies financial expertise to costing data and uses these rates—along with labor estimates, tooling, and capital expenditures—to develop and communicate precise product costs supporting customer quotations for new products and engineering changes. The analyst analyzes complex BOMs and manufacturing processes, communicates cost drivers, assumptions, and implications organization-wide, and partners cross-functionally to educate teams on product cost structure. Collaborating with Sales, Engineering, Manufacturing, Purchasing and Assembly. Running scenario analysis changing for various cost and pricing options. An ideal candidate quickly analyzes complex business situations to drive profit-focused outcomes. Key Responsibilities Develops labor and overhead rates while partnering cross-functionally to educate teams on product cost structure. Applies financial expertise to costing data and communicates cost drivers, assumptions, and implications organization-wide. Analyzes complex Bills of Materials (BOMs) to develop accurate product costs, including raw materials, purchased parts, labor, overhead, tooling, and capital for new programs and engineering changes. Builds and analyzes financial models incorporating price/cost sensitivity analysis. Serves as a valued business partner to Sales and Product Line Managers, contributing to pricing strategies that secure new business. Delivers comprehensive customer quote packages, including piece prices, tooling breakdowns, and price walks from current to future states. Tracks program margins from launch to completion, ensuring alignment with quote targets. Partners with Engineering, Purchasing, Manufacturing, Quality, Assembly, and other departments to explain product costs, identify savings opportunities, and drive cost reductions. Develops and maintains sales forecasts and budgets for assigned products. Performs additional duties as assigned. Qualifications Required Qualifications Four-year college technical degree in Finance, Business Administration, or related field. 6-10 years of experience in product costing in manufacturing Advanced Microsoft Excel proficiency (financial modeling, pivot tables, index-match). Strong financial and analytical skills (e.g., make-vs-buy analysis, net present value) Strong communication skills, including executive presentations Proven interpersonal and teamwork abilities Preferred Qualifications Experience in product costing in automotive industry Foreign language skills in Spanish
